Filling direction

Front Filling or Rear Filling?

The correct direction follows the syringe structure, component supply state and product behavior.

Veterinary syringe front filling station
Machine reference
Nozzle-end entry

Front Filling

Product enters from the nozzle end before the remaining package components are assembled.

IntramammaryUterine applicatorsGel bait
Rear filling and plunger insertion for oral paste syringe
Machine reference
Barrel-tail entry

Rear Filling

Product enters through the open barrel tail, followed by controlled venting and plunger insertion.

Technical FAQ

Questions We Resolve Before Recommending Equipment

Is the product a liquid, suspension, cream, gel or paste?

This determines the dosing principle, hopper, transfer method, nozzle and whether heating or agitation should be evaluated.

Should the syringe be filled from the front or rear?

The route depends on how the barrel, tip closure, piston and plunger are supplied and assembled. We confirm it from samples.

What package samples are required?

Please provide the complete syringe set, drawings, tolerances, bulk packing and the supply state of each component.

What determines final speed and accuracy?

Formulation behavior, target dose, package tolerances, feeding stability and the agreed quality criteria.

Dosage-form engineering

Different Formulations Need Different Process Routes

We start with how the material behaves, then configure the contact path, dosing and assembly modules.

High-viscosity veterinary paste rear filling process diagramProcess diagram
A
Paste · Gel · Cream · Sealant

High-Viscosity Paste Route

  • Evaluate the product at its real filling temperature
  • Match hopper, transfer and dosing to material resistance
  • Tune nozzle withdrawal, cut-off and plunger venting
Veterinary suspension and cream precision filling process diagramProcess diagram
B
Suspension · Cream

Suspension & Cream Route

  • Check settling, separation and bubble sensitivity
  • Protect narrow tips and flexible package geometry
  • Confirm dose repeatability, venting and cleanability
